    Abstract: A three-axis antenna positioner has an X-Y over azimuth configuration, and includes an azimuth drive assembly, an X-axis drive assembly, and a Y-axis drive assembly. Each drive assembly is independently operable. The azimuth drive assembly imparts 540° azimuthal rotational motion to an antenna about an azimuth axis. The X-axis drive assembly rotates the antenna about a horizontal X-axis at elevation angles between ?90° and +90°. The Y-axis drive assembly rotates the antenna about a Y-axis at elevation complement angles between ?2° and +105°. The azimuth axis, the X-axis, and the Y-axis all intersect at a common intersection point, and are mutually orthogonal. A controller operates each drive assembly so as to minimize antenna tracking velocity and acceleration. Each drive assembly may include dual drives, and may be operated in a bias drive mode to substantially eliminate backlash.

    Abstract: The present invention relates to an electrostatic speaker including a fixed electrode and a diaphragm that is arranged with a predetermined gap from the fixed electrode and has a plurality of ventilation holes. The ventilative diaphragm reduces air resistance caused by the ground effect between the fixed electrode and the diaphragm, and increases the sound pressure output from the speaker. As a result, the ventilative diaphragm makes it possible to obtain a uniform frequency reproduction characteristic over the entire frequency range. In particular, when the diaphragm is made from Korean paper, it is possible to effectively reduce the ground effect occurring between the fixed electrode and the diaphragm due to the air permeable characteristic of the Korean paper and the air resistance due to a surge input signal, while satisfying physical characteristics of the existing diaphragm. In addition, since the Korean paper has high formability, it is possible to easily form the diaphragm in a hemispherical shape.
